From Digital Living Today If you're looking for an entry-level DVD player with all the features you need to be up and watching movies late into the night, look no further than the Sony NS400D, a new model from Sony that incorporates the latest advances in DVD technology in a budget-priced unit. On the audio side, a Dolby Digital 5.1 decoder allows the NS400D to take advantage of the latest Surround Sound technology in your home AV system. Adjustable channel controls (uncommon in a unit of this price) allow you actually to optimize the sound reproduction in your specific listening environment. On the video end of things, the 400d packs in a plethora of features, including an impressive new digital technology that both sharpens the image and keeps it looking natural. On-screen menus allow you to control everything with ease from the multi-feature remote. An enhanced Bookmark feature makes it easy to set placeholders for up to 50 DVDs. Sony's Precision Drive 2 and Dynamic Tilt Compensation allow for better tracking of imperfect disks. A variety of outputs, including S-Video, Optical digital, Coax digital, Dolby 5.1 and analog stereo top off this feature-packed, budget-friendly DVD find from Sony.
The Best Bang for your Buck. I own three other DVD players and am familiar with a friend's, and none of them have performed for me quite so well as this one. Its sheer number of options in almost all aspects of DVD (and CD music) enetertainment along with flexibility in terms of control and viewing make this a great deal all on its own. Having had so much experience with other players, I had soon put this one through its paces.The remote control is large and solid, its weight comfortable to the hand and reassuring of the quality that went into its making. The buttons are intelligently placed rather than just shoved on where they would fit and the are all of high quality and comfortable to press. After only two days of use I can already find most of the options without having to search for them, which is good since there is no sort of backlighting or glow in the dark plastic.Advancing to different tracks on the DVD is very fast, no slow down when trying to access the next scene like I have sometimes seen with cheaper players. The rewind and forward buttons are part of the flexibility I previously mentioned. There is the option to SCAN the disc with multiple speeds x3 as well as a push and release SEARCH for when you just want to scan back a few seconds. This way you aren't bothered pressing the SCAN button then rushing to press the PLAY to stop it. Just press and release when done.I won't go into all the features, but it includes everything you'd expect a DVD player to have. Slow motion with multiple stepped speeds similar to the SCAN in both forward and reverse. Angles and subtitles and audio options along with shuffle, repeat, and programmed playback for listening to CDs. Time and chapter searches, noise reduction (for DVDs that tend to pixilate) and a picture sharperner/softener. The only oddly lacking feature would be the absence of a zoom button.A nice feature that my previous DVDs didn't have is the automatic saving of settings for the DVD you're viewing. The player will save your settings for up to 50 DVDs automatically. Once you get past 50 it just overwrites the oldest one saved so that any you watch on a regular basis will always be set how you like. This way you don't have to mess with menu and audio/picture options everytime you sit down to watch a movie. There is also a 9 screen splitscreen option that you can use to speed up searches during playback, view scenes from each chapter if the DVD doesn't offer this on the menu, and view all the different angles available at once.Audio options are many and varied, allowing not only for the selection of the number of speakers and types (front, back, center, subwoofer) but also for the size of the speakers and the distance of each from the viewer for optimal sound performance. In addition to this there are various sound setups for theater quality sound in a variety of styles. There's even an option to make your music CDs sound like you're in the best seats at a concert hall in Venice. There is even a setting for viewing DVDs at night which will keep you from having to constantly adjust the volume during the loud scenes.There is also a DTS converter of some sort, I haven't figured out the logistics of it yet... but apparently you can achieve DTS sound without the need of a receiver that will supply such. There are also S-Video hookups for ultimate screen performance as well as YPR connections for an even better picture and more accurate colors.There is only one thing I can really find against the player. The menus are big and rather ugly. The saving grace here is they are very easy to manipulate to do what you want quickly and get them off of your screen.All in all this is a great DVD player, and I am very glad that the folks I talked to got me to buy this one instead of the one I had in mind. I haven't even begun to touch on all of the other keen things this player can do, but if you're not convinced by now... well, there's nothing I can do but invite you over to see this thing in action in person.
